Our first IPA features a generous addition of aromatic hops giving this hazy brew massive tropical notes right upfront. Light-bodied and very refreshing, it finishes off crisp with a slight, lingering bitterness.

For some reason, my rating of this got deleted. 473mL can, pours a cloudy opaque yellow with a small white head. Nose is fairly dank, with lots of yeast, some pithy stone fruits. Flavour follows through, with a pleasantly dank and not too yeasty hop character. Fairly nice example of the style.

Cloudy blond color. The aroma is mildly dank, lightly piney. Dry and smooth mouthfeel; delicate malt base, quite good hopping, resins, a bit too astringent in the finish.
Quite good.

Very pale and opaque. Almost greyish. On the nose, it's more yeasty than anything else. Seems like a fair bit of vanilla. Low bitterness, with a touch of yeasty character. Light fruit, but very lot hop character for something called an IPA. Not hating it , but it's not giving me anything to work with.
